Queen Elizabeth's love for dogs might be known to many, but the fact that she has created an entirely new breed is a lesser-known fact.

The Queen takes credit for creating a hybrid between dachshund and the corgi, called dorgi right after Princess Margaret's dachshund Pipkin mated with the monarch's corgis. 

An experiment that rather proved successful, caused the royal to breed their own little army of furballs. 

Over the year, the family welcomed Cider, Rum, Berry, Candy, Brandy, Chipper, Harris, Pickles, Piper, Tinker and Vulcan.

Not to mention, the 95-year-old monarch is also the Patron of the Dogs Trust dog welfare organization in the U.K.
